To begin with this recipe, we must first prepare a few ingredients. You can cook dried oyster and chicken in wine stew using 14 ingredients and 6 steps. Here is how you cook it.

The ingredients needed to make Dried Oyster And Chicken In Wine Stew:
  1. Make ready dry korean oyster
  2. Make ready cinnamon
  3. Take star anise
  4. Take water
  5. Prepare shao xing wine
  6. Get sugar
  7. Prepare dang gui herbs ( angelica slice)
  8. Prepare chicken feet or chicken wing
  9. Make ready SAUCE
  10. Prepare light soy sauce
  11. Make ready oyster sauce
  12. Prepare dark soy sauce
  13. Make ready CORNSTACH
  14. Take cornstarch diluted in hslf cup of water
Instructions to make Dried Oyster And Chicken In Wine Stew:
  1. COOKING OPTION IN A POT 1 AND A HALF HOUR OR 40 MINUTE IN OR PREASURE COOKER
  2. put chicken and oyster with cinnamon stick and star anise with enough water to cover chicken
  3. add dang gui and all 3 sauce in and mix well
  4. THICKEN SAUCE
  5. put sauce on pan bring to a boil then add cornstarch water to thicken sauce
  6. add in chicken and sugar with shao xing wine then off hest and serve immediately
